Chinese vendor launches first workstation PC with Intel’s fastest CPU and up to two Arc Pro B60 GPUs, possibly with 48GB of RAM each
MaxSun’s Mini Station fuses dual GPUs and mobile silicon into a compact desktop unit With 48GB of VRAM, it’s clearly built for demanding creative and AI inference tasks Dual Thunderbolt 5 ports and SlimSAS slots push bandwidth to a theoretical 192Gbps MaxSun has introduced what it claims is the industry’s…
